Normally I cringe at these types of crossovers (i.e. Star Trek/Legion of Superheroes, Star Trek/X-Men, etc).  But for some reason this one has captured my interest.  I think it's Matt Smith.  If it had been Christopher Eccleston or David Tennant I think I still would have cringed.  However, Matt Smith is quirky enough that this might be a fun comic to read.

Just read the first issue of "Doctor Who/Star Trek: The Next Generation - Assimilated2".  It was surprisingly enjoyable!  It was more Doctor Who-centric than Star Trek, but still fun.  The writer really captured the voice and humor of the Doctor, Amy, and Rory.

I recommend it if you are a fan of both franchises.
